Disney’s “The Lion King” might still reign supreme, but Quentin Tarantino’s “Once Upon a Time in Hollywood” certainly held its own. Quentin Tarantino’s R-rated ode to Hollywood’s golden age opened with $40 million from 3,659 North American theaters, says Reuters. The movie also scored an opening day record for Tarantino, amassing $16.8 million on Friday. "The Lion King" still held on to its top box office spot, raking in another $75.5 million.
